What you will learn: 

In this course, part of the Health Links™ series, you will receive a comprehensive guide to creating family-friendly workplaces. Through a collection of short videos and exercises led by industry leaders and Total Worker Health experts, you will gain the skills and tools necessary for fostering a supportive environment for employees and their families. Participants will examine the need for and define what constitutes a family-friendly workplace, analyze the business case for implementing such practices, and identify the key components of family-friendly workplaces along with examples of best practices using evidence-based tools and resources.

After completing this course, learners will be able to: 

  • Examine the need for, and define, family-friendly workplaces.
  • Analyze the business case for family-friendly workplaces.
  • Identify the components of family-friendly workplaces and give examples of best practices.
  • Apply evidence-based tools and resources for creating a family-friendly workplace.
